## Escalation: Queue Log Compaction

If Brinefeld's compaction lag tops 30 minutes, don't panic — check disk headroom on the broker nodes first. Usually it's a stuck segment cleaner; a rolling restart clears it. If lag keeps climbing after two restarts, or consumers start erroring, escalate. The messaging platform crew owns this and answers fastest by mail.

escalation mailbox, yajeg-bageg: quenax.olidor@lumiccorp.internal

Ticket: Staging env misconfigured for Siftgate bloom filter

The bloom layer in front of the Pellet KV store is rejecting all lookups in staging because the env file was copied from the dev template without credentials. False-positive tuning values are fine; only the auth line is missing. To unblock the weekly demo, the Pellet admission secret must be set on the following line.

env line for yaguf-fajop: LEDGER_TOKEN13=fb08984397349

Action item from the Tabulon export incident: the XLSX writer buffered entire worksheets in memory, peaking at 9 GB on the Orvane tenant. We've switched to streaming row batches with a bounded cell cache, owned by the Ferris pod, due next sprint. The batch and cache limits we settled on are listed below.

tuning constants:
QUOTAS = {
    "druwyn": 5,
    "holix": 5,
    "zorath": 5,
    "holwyn": 10,
}

Ticket: ProctorLane exam queue drops candidates when the invigilator pool rebalances mid-session. Suspect the queue consumer acks before session handoff completes; candidates land in a ghost state and never reconnect. Repro: rebalance with >50 active sessions on staging. Fix in review moves the ack after handoff confirmation and adds an idempotency guard. Please verify the guard against the trace token below.

build token for kagaf-hahof: htk14_9d3d4d26d7d8de

# Break-Glass: Catalog Cache Invalidation

Scope: the Pinrow product catalog at Veldstone Retail. If stale prices persist after a purge and the Hollowmere invalidation queue is wedged, use break-glass to flush the edge tier directly. Contractors: get verbal sign-off from the catalog lead first. Steps: open the Hollowmere admin shell, select emergency-flush, confirm the tenant, and run it once — repeated flushes thrash the origin. Access is logged and expires after 20 minutes. Unseal the admin shell with the passphrase below.

recovery phrase for kahop-tajog: istix-casvan